A reaction whose only objective is to make individuals tidy via bespoke, personalised combinations of plants and salts. Soap is made by combining fatty acids and sodium hydroxide (lye) together.


How Southern Natural Llc can Save You Time, Stress, and Money.


The scientific word for this response is saponification. Fatty acids are fats, butters and oils such as coconut oil, olive oil, or rapeseed oil, to name just a couple of. These oils comprise the base of 100% natural soap bars. By choosing to make use of organic oils over animal fats, soap makers can conveniently make their soap vegetarian.


It is very important to keep in mind that lye needs to always be poured right into the water, as putting water onto lye creates a hazardous chemical reaction referred to as a 'lye volcano'. The next action is to evaluate out any base oils or butters; these are your fats. Oils that are strong at area temperature need to be gently thawed prior to combining with the already liquid ones.


This part of the soap making procedure is understood as reaching trace. In the hot process approach, it will take much longer for the batter to get to trace due to the fact that the blend needs to cook and thicken longer in order to finish the saponification process. Once the batter has reached trace, any type of essential oils, colourants, or additives require to be mixed into the blend.

Once completely integrated, the batter is ready to be poured into moulds and left to cool in a secure location. This is the component where we like to obtain a little imaginative and leading our soap loaves with lovely, organic ingredients so that they look wonderful in your bathroom. Don't be deceived! Covering soap with a little touch of finery does not just make them pretty.


In the chilly soap making process, soap batter needs to be left for 1 day to saponify when it can be removed from the moulds and sliced right into bars. These will certainly require to be delegated treat for 6-8 weeks prior to they are safe for usage. In the warm soap making process, the batter requires to be scooped into moulds and left overnight to cool.


Now that the soap bars have ended up treating, they can be eliminated from their moulds and utilized to keep your body, face and hands fresh and tidy. Soap making can be a dangerous process as a result of the usage of lye, as a result it is vital to make certain that you have actually viewed the appropriate security video clips and are totally clued up before trying this at home.

Every one of the chemistry is completed for you prior to you also open the plan which indicates less to be careful of. Likewise, more to have a good time with! To use it, all you do is cut it into small items and melt it either in the microwave or over reduced warmth.


You can additionally add extremely small amounts of added oil, like thawed shea butter or pleasant almond oil to melt-and-pour soap bases for added conditioning. Color can also be contributed to thaw and pour soap at this factor before you put the batter right into mold and mildews. Splash the tops with alcohol to decrease air bubbles and produce a smooth coating.


Make use of a microwave or dual central heating boiler to thaw M&P soap Melt-and-pour soap has a lot going all out. It's wonderful for beginner soap manufacturers or if you would love to make soap with kids. That's because there's no lye handling action to be mindful of and you can utilize benches as soon as possible.
